So what’s with the new banner? Well, the three characters looking away from the screen are characters from an unfinished book of mine called “Weather Or Not”. They are – from left to right – Raymond, Haley and Willard (named after Willard Scott – the first Ronald MacDonald and the guy who does the weather on NBC’s Today Show). Why are they looking away from the screen rather than towards it? Well, in their defense, they didn’t actually know that there was going to be a screen behind them. Seriously though it’s just one of the scenes from the story where they’re about to go into the “forbidden room”. It’s also the only “rough” picture that’s finished at the moment but there’s parts of other pictures on the go. In retrospect though it probably would’ve been much better to have first done one of the pictures where their faces could be seen. That way it’s easier for people to “identify” with the characters better. Oh well, you live and learn!
Anyhow, I rescanned the original artwork, cut them out from the “page” with Photoshop’s lasso tool and pasted them in a new file. Then I thought “What next????”, and chucked a indigo oval with a stroke around it and the name of the blog in yellow (well, you can see that obviously so I’m not really sure why I’m describing it!)
